The ongoing REMIT review is reshaping the regulatory landscape and creating fresh uncertainty for market participants. In this Commodities People webinar, Chirag Ahuja, Director of Implementation at BroadPeak, along with other leading experts, examines the most significant developments expected in the year ahead and discuss how these changes could affect trading behaviour, compliance strategies, and market transparency.

Agenda

  • Evolving thresholds for what qualifies as inside information
  • New requirements for reporting hydrogen transactions
  • Expectations around exposure reporting
  • Other reporting challenges
  • Obligations for market surveillance, including around algo trading
